## Alert: Partition Rollover Failure — Ledgerloom

This alert fires when the monthly partition for the transactions table has not been created by the 25th of the preceding month. Writes will fall through to the default partition, degrading query performance and complicating later backfills. Do not proceed with a release while this alert is active. Verify the partition job logs and confirm the next month's partition exists. Remediation steps are documented here:

dashboard of bajog-fahif = https://confluence.zemvarlabs.internal/display/display/display/2c2702ee

### Connection Pooling

The Orrery API tier holds a pool per service instance against the primary Mallowdene cluster. Pool sizing must account for replica failover, since connections double briefly during promotion. New team members: never raise the pool max without checking aggregate limits across all instances, or the database will hit its cap. Current pool settings are:

tuning constants:
BUDGETS = {
    "druath": 240,
    "lamwyn": 180,
    "silael": 275,
}

**Step 7 — GridWright signing key rotation.** Reviewer confirms the new ed25519 key for the GridWright crossword generator build pipeline is sealed in the Harlox vault. Verify two witnesses initialed the log, old key marked revoked, and CI secrets rotated before merge approval. Do not approve the PR until the vault entry is live. The recovery passphrase for the sealed key follows below.

strongbox words: oliael-istix